Customer Relationship Management Tools

Customer relationship management tools are software applications designed to help businesses manage interactions with clients and streamline processes related to customer engagement. These tools facilitate the organization, automation, and analysis of customer information and interactions, which significantly enhances the ability to build client relationships.

A well-implemented CRM tool allows businesses to maintain detailed records of client interactions, track communication history, and manage sales pipelines. Popular options like Salesforce, HubSpot, and Zoho CRM provide features such as campaign management, lead tracking, and analytics, enabling businesses to tailor their services effectively according to client needs.

Integration of these tools with existing systems enhances operational efficiency and ensures that valuable client data is easily accessible across departments. With robust reporting features, businesses can better analyze client behavior and preferences, making data-driven decisions that further improve relationship-building efforts.

Utilizing CRM tools also fosters better communication within teams, ensuring that everyone is aligned on client-related activities. By centralizing client information and providing insights, these tools play a pivotal role in enhancing client engagement and satisfaction, key components of successful client relationship management.

Measuring the Success of Client Relationships

Measuring the success of client relationships involves evaluating various performance indicators that reflect the health and longevity of these interactions. Key metrics include client satisfaction, retention rates, and referral frequency, which collectively illustrate the effectiveness of your client engagement strategies.

Client satisfaction can be gauged through surveys and feedback forms, providing valuable insights into how well your services meet client needs. Observing client retention rates also offers a quantitative measure of relationship success. High retention often correlates with strong engagement and satisfaction levels, suggesting a positive connection.

Additionally, monitoring referral frequency serves as another powerful indicator. When clients refer your services to others, it signifies trust and loyalty, essential components of building client relationships. An increase in referrals indicates that clients view your interactions as beneficial and worthwhile.

This systematic approach to measuring the success of client relationships can help fine-tune strategies for ongoing collaboration. By understanding which metrics are most telling, you can adapt methods to enhance interactions, ensuring lasting partnerships in the competitive realm of content writing.
